Prospective Risks Involved
While the benefits are significant, there are also considerable threats related to online drug stores that do not require prescriptions:

Quality and Safety: There is a possible danger of receiving counterfeit or substandard medications that might be inadequate or harmful.

Absence of Professional Guidance: Without a prescription, clients lose out on important consultations regarding drug interactions, adverse effects, and correct usage.

Legal Issues: Purchasing medications without a prescription can result in legal implications for both the purchaser and the online seller, as it often violates health policies.

Health Complications: Self-medicating without professional oversight can result in mismanagement of conditions, causing extreme long-lasting health problems.

Are online pharmacies safe?
While some Online Drug Purchase drug stores operate legally and securely, numerous pose risks, particularly those that do not need prescriptions. It's vital to verify the pharmacy's qualifications before making any purchases.
2. How can I inform if an online pharmacy is legitimate?
Look for pharmacies that are certified and follow regulative requirements. You may inspect for accreditation seals, such as Verified Internet Pharmacy Practice Sites (VIPPS) in the U.S., and read consumer evaluations for extra assurance.
3. What should I do if I think I've gotten counterfeit medication?
If you suspect that you have actually received fake medication, report it to your regional pharmacy board or the relevant health authority immediately. Do not take in the medication.
